Transaction 082181e12252e9558a987c233047468e61379239209047ce0e9f48abd5148b25

1 Input
2 Outputs
  • 082181e12252e9558a987c233047468e61379239209047ce0e9f48abd5148b25:0
  • value  45442
    address  3MFBiXFhaiq5qb1xf5J6QugEeK6ofgC1Wg
  • 082181e12252e9558a987c233047468e61379239209047ce0e9f48abd5148b25:1
  • value  8577708
    address  1D3fpcwx7k8oM1pifLPUi2iibM2USKhArP